X-Git-Url: http://git.xonotic.org/?a=blobdiff_plain;f=screen.h;h=4d473244db46f261e0cc80843c3a4487e5ac5e03;hb=023c4cb84d787baea342f95b951ca3366f337df4;hp=05befb2c65b101e7c42b00c956e9973aac74b4d5;hpb=2539ebf5b336636f0bb1a6532dd8a4c320e0c2d8;p=xonotic%2Fdarkplaces.git diff --git a/screen.h b/screen.h index 05befb2c..4d473244 100644 --- a/screen.h +++ b/screen.h @@ -26,10 +26,10 @@ void CL_Screen_Init (void); void CL_UpdateScreen (void); void SCR_CenterPrint(const char *str); -void SCR_BeginLoadingPlaque (void); +void SCR_BeginLoadingPlaque (qboolean startup); // invoke refresh of loading plaque (nothing else seen) -void SCR_UpdateLoadingScreen(qboolean clear); +void SCR_UpdateLoadingScreen(qboolean clear, qboolean startup); void SCR_UpdateLoadingScreenIfShown(void); // pushes an item on the loading screen @@ -66,5 +66,26 @@ extern cvar_t r_letterbox; extern cvar_t scr_refresh; extern cvar_t scr_stipple; +extern cvar_t r_stereo_separation; +extern cvar_t r_stereo_angle; +qboolean R_Stereo_Active(void); +extern int r_stereo_side; + +typedef struct scr_touchscreenarea_s +{ + const char *pic; + const char *text; + float rect[4]; + float textheight; + float active; + float activealpha; + float inactivealpha; +} +scr_touchscreenarea_t; + +// FIXME: should resize dynamically? +extern int scr_numtouchscreenareas; +extern scr_touchscreenarea_t scr_touchscreenareas[128]; + #endif